Get your quote now!The cost of IVF with Sperm Donation and Gender Selection in Kyrenia, Cyprus, typically ranges from $10,000 to $16,000 USD. This price often includes the core procedure but can vary based on specific clinic offerings and individual patient needs.
Seeking fertility treatment abroad, especially a complex procedure like IVF with both sperm donation and gender selection, naturally brings cost to the forefront of your decision-making. Kyrenia, Cyprus, has become a popular destination due to its advanced medical facilities and competitive pricing compared to many Western countries. The quoted range covers a comprehensive cycle, but it's crucial to understand what this encompasses.
This estimate usually includes the medical procedures like egg retrieval, fertilization with donor sperm, preimplantation genetic testing (PGT) for gender selection, and embryo transfer. However, factors such as the specific donor sperm characteristics, the extent of genetic screening, and any necessary pre-treatments can cause the final price to fluctuate. It's always best to get a personalized quote that details every included service.

Typically, domestic or international health insurance plans do not cover fertility treatments like IVF with sperm donation and gender selection, especially when performed abroad for elective purposes. It's always best to verify directly with your insurance provider.
The vast majority of health insurance policies, both within your home country and international plans, consider fertility treatments, particularly those involving gender selection, as elective procedures. This means they are generally not covered. IVF, even without gender selection, is often categorized this way unless specific medical conditions are met and it's performed in your home country.
For treatments sought abroad, the likelihood of coverage diminishes even further. It's imperative to contact your insurance provider directly and inquire about their specific policies regarding assisted reproductive technologies (ART) and international medical care. Do not assume any coverage without written confirmation, as this can lead to unexpected financial burdens.

Medication costs for IVF can be substantial, often ranging from $2,000 to $5,000 USD or more per cycle. This includes fertility drugs for ovarian stimulation, hormone support, and other necessary prescriptions throughout the treatment process.
The cost of medication is a significant component of the total IVF expense and is frequently overlooked in initial price quotes. These drugs are essential for stimulating your ovaries to produce multiple eggs, preparing your uterus for implantation, and supporting the early stages of pregnancy. The cost of freezing and storing embryos or sperm typically involves an initial fee for the freezing process (vitrification) and then an annual storage fee. These can range from a few hundred to over a thousand dollars annually, depending on the clinic and storage duration.
Many couples choose to freeze surplus embryos from an IVF cycle, or individuals may opt to freeze sperm for future use or before certain medical procedures. This offers flexibility and can potentially save costs on future full IVF cycles.
